Howard Besnia: Speared by the Spires of Boylston Street & Knight

Lot # 94 (Sale Order: 163 of 690)      

Howard Besnia(American, 1921-2014): Two pieces: Speared by the Spires of Boylston Street: Relief etching on paper printed by the artist at Scarab Studios in Sterling, MA, marked 1/34, signed and dated '67, with identifying information verso, framed. Knight: Woodblock print printed by the artist at Scarab Studios in Sterling, MA, signed, marked 1/36, with information verso, framed. Howard Besnia was a prolific painter and printsman known for his eclectic oeuvre and his handmade books. Beginning as a cartographer for the United States Army in 1994, he soon became the staff artist for many USO clubs, producing caricatures and portraits of the troops After subsequent training at the Corcoran School of Art, Clark University and Yale University, Besnia went on to chair the art department at Fitchburg State University for decades
Speared by the Spires of Boylston Street: 5 9/10 x 9" paper, 14 9/10 x 18 9/10" frame; Knight: 4 x 7 1/2" paper, 14 9/10 x 18 9/10" frame

Joseph Goodhue Chandler: Daniel Webster Portrait

Lot # 99A (Sale Order: 174 of 690)      

Joseph Goodhue Chandler (American 1813-1884) Manner of: Portrait of Daniel Webster oil on canvas unsigned framed. Label attached reverse identifies the sitter as Daniel Webster. Artist name and date are written in graphite across top stretcher bar: Joseph Goodhue Chandler 1852.

Joseph G Chandler was born in South Hadley Massachusetts where his family owned a small farm. After a brief apprenticeship with a cabinetmaker he studied painting in Albany New York between the years 1827-1832. Most of his known paintings date from 1837-1852 a period when he traveled parts of the Connecticut River Valley particularly northwestern Massachusetts working as an itinerant painter until he established a studio in Boston in 1852.

Good aged condition: craqueleure across the surface surface dirt scratches and areas of paint loss.

Size: 15.75 x 13.5 Canvas Size/ 19 x 17 Frame Size

Provenance: Private collection Massachusetts
